The Director, Biosample Operations Manager will be responsible for ensuring robust and efficient sample shipment, sample testing and data reporting. You will report to the SVP of Development Operations and be a member of the Development Operations group and play an essential role in organizing complex clinical sample management processes across multiple clinical programs. Areas of responsibility include coordination between the central biorepository lab, CROs, all groups within Sana collecting clinical samples, clinical operations and clinical data management, as well as alignment of clinical sample management activities with individual program and corporate goals.  Cool stuff.

What you’ll do

  • Will be the point of contact and functional lead for all operational activities relating to vendor and sample management plans in order to deliver quality samples used in clinical studies
  • Serve as the on-going operational point of contact between clinical study team, CRO, central and testing labs for communication regarding sample logistics and availability, batching and testing timelines, reanalysis, and data reporting
  • Interface and collaborate with Clinical operations, Biomarker lead, Central lab, specialty labs, other Sana functions as necessary and CRO to generate the Lab Manual and Flow Chart
  • Support Clinical Data Management on generation of Biomarker Assay Data Transfer documents
  • Oversee shipping and receipt of patient samples from central labs to assay laboratories. Provide sample shipment and analysis metrics and status updates to product development teams
  • Oversight of the tracking of budget and timelines for clinical testing labs and communication with internal stakeholders on tracking
  • Identify sample discrepancies and missing samples, request queries, track queries and assist in query resolution. Identify stakeholders for questions impacting analysis and custody of samples and escalates issues to internal and external parties to ensure a timely resolution
  • Maintain sample and data repository. Support sample analysis data transfer, data reconciliation and data review
  • Responsible for data handling/archiving at the completion of the study and coordinating archiving of clinical samples with all groups at Sana collecting clinical samples
  • Work with clinical team to review and set up clinical documents, and ensure all stakeholders are involved for the review
  • Help create efficient sample flow in partnership with all departments collecting clinical samples at Sana
